Specifications
- Product Status: Active
- Type: General Purpose
- Number of Elements: 2
- Output Type: Open-Drain, Rail-to-Rail
- Voltage - Supply, Single/Dual (±): 1.65V ~ 5.5V
- Voltage - Input Offset (Max): 2mV @ 5V
- Current - Input Bias (Max): 5pA @ 5V
- Current - Output (Typ): 100mA @ 5V
- Current - Quiescent (Max): 35µA
- CMRR, PSRR (Typ): 65dB CMRR, 80dB PSRR
- Propagation Delay (Max): 600ns (Typ)
- Hysteresis: -
- Operating Temperature: -40°C ~ 125°C
- Package / Case: SOT-23-8
- Mounting Type: Surface Mount
- Supplier Device Package: TSOT-23-8
